Who Was Sinclair Beiles?

by Gary Cummiskey The following is an excerpt from Gary Cummiskey and Eva Kowalska, Who Was Sinclair Beiles?, published in 2009 by Dye Hard Press. The book contains interviews and essays that create a portrait of Sinclair Beiles, the South African poet who worked for Olympia Press, helped to edit Naked Lunch, and collaborated with…

Minutes to Go

[M&M A3] Paris: Two Cities Editions 1960, bound in wraps, one of 1,000 copies. Maynard & Miles A3a. A collaborative effort between Burroughs, Brion Gysin, Sinclair Beiles, and Gregory Corso, and the first of the “cut-up” publications. There was also a limited edition of 10 copies (only five of which were for sale) each signed…
